Using a consultant (HR 17)

Getting results

Bringing in the outside expertise of a consultant can solve problems and help you improve processes, products and profitability.

Choosing the right consultant for the job is half the battle. The other half, which this briefing covers, is then to get the best possible results. Obviously your approach will depend on whether the consultant has worked with you before, and how long, complex and costly the project will be.

The briefing covers:

  • Preparing the briefing for the consultant.
  • The consultancy agreement, including fees and expenses.
  • Managing the contract.
  • Resolving any problems.
